Transaction

fbe6e4d939ed24c8e1d23d093431399d2d35e672f07706765ceb19a88dab2fb2
323,436 confirmations
Timestamp
1580946751
Block616,160
Fee3,870 sats
Fee rate15.1 sats/vB
view on mempool.space

Inputs & Outputs